[leafnode-list] Ambigous Message-ID
Hallo out there,
by checking some of my last postings I saw that my system produces
Message-ID's like:
Message-ID: <nqc2fa.3pa.ln@localhost>
I think @localhost is not that what it should be, right? I'm not sure
which software produces that Message-ID, but because of the *.ln@*
I think it's leafnode. What to do to correct this behaviour?
Here are some information about my system:
andreas@home:~ > uname -a
Linux home 2.4.16-4GB #1 Tue Dec 18 15:10:30 GMT 2001 i686 unknown
andreas@home:~ > rpm -q leafnode
leafnode-1.9.22.rel-1
andreas@home:~ > rpm -q tin
tin-1.5.12-2
andreas@home:~ > cat /etc/hosts | grep '127.0.0.1'
127.0.0.1 localhost
127.0.0.1 home.apo-im-plauen-park.de home
andreas@home:~ > cat /etc/nntpserver
home.apo-im-plauen-park.de
